Hi,

 

We are booked on Voyager in April to Singapore.

 

We actually arrive the second last day and then overnight in Singapore.

 

I would like to attend a fun run (Parkrun) on the final day at 7am in Singapore. Can I leave the ship at 530am and return at 830am to finally leave the ship with family at 9-10am?

 

The latest departure from the ship is 10am from what my travel agent has told me.

Once you leave the ship on the last day they will not let you return. You will have passed through immigration and customs and ill be counted as leaving the ship. Singapore immigration is very efficient and efficacious.

 

You can leave early, then the rest of the family leaves later meeting you at the pier. They will be off by around 9 am.
